New insolvency manager for McAlister & Co’s Ystrad Mynach office

Insolvency practitioners McAlister & Co has appointed a key manager to work out of its Ystrad Mynach office.

Simon Barriball has joined the growing firm as an insolvency manager. His specialisms include helping small businesses overcome tough financial difficulties.

The 29-year-old will be based at McAlister’s Ystrad Mynach office and its Swansea headquarters.

An accountancy and finance graduate of Aberystwyth University, Mr Barriball has eight years of experience in business recovery.

He said: “I’m excited to be joining McAlister & Co; they’re a young firm with a real focus on business turnarounds and with great ambition to develop and grow.

“I know the MD, Sandra McAlister, really well having worked with her for several years from 2003. We have a profound mutual professional respect and I look forward to helping her drive the business forward.”

Sandra McAlister said: “We’re delighted to have Simon on board. He’s an ambitious insolvency practitioner with great drive and professionalism.”
